Ghana and AFC Bournemouth attacker Antoine Semenyo is eager to begin the new year with a victory as his side hosts Everton at Vitality Stadium on Saturday.
The Black and Red are heading into the game against Everton unbeaten in their last five matches in the English Premier League.
Speaking ahead of the encounter, Semenyo said: “It’s going to be a tough game and obviously, in the last game we played, it took us until late on to come back and get a result,” he told afcb.co.uk.
“They’ll make it really uncomfortable for us but I feel like if we come out of the gates blazing, it’ll be tough for them.”
“It’s the first game of 2025 and we want to win, 100%.”
The Ghanaian forward scored 10 goals and provided three assists in 35 Premier League appearances.
